Director JKEDI, Ajaz Ahmad Bhat conducts extensive tour of Shadab Karewa

Director, Jammu and Kashmir Entrepreneurship Development Institute (JKEDI), Ajaz Ahmad Bhat (IAS), who is the Prabhari Officer of Shadab Karewa, Shopian, conducted a comprehensive inspection of various developmental projects in the area today. The primary objective of this inspection was to evaluate the progress of important initiatives, with a primary focus on the ongoing construction of a 50000 Gallons water service reservoir at Mir Mohalla and the laying of water supply pipes falling under the ambit of the Jal Shakti Department.

Ajaz Ahmad Bhat initiated his visit by closely examining the construction of the water reservoir at Mir Mohalla. This reservoir holds paramount importance in ensuring a consistent and reliable water supply for the residents of the tail end areas of Shadab Karewa. While reviewing the ongoing works, Ajaz Ahmad Bhat emphasized the significance of completing this vital infrastructure before the onset of winter. He stressed on the essential role the reservoir would play in ameliorating water scarcity issues in the area.

During the visit, Prabhari Officer, Ajaz Ahmad Bhat also assessed the progress of the water supply pipe laying project, an integral component of the Jal Jeevan Mission. It was reported that a commendable milestone has been achieved, with 3 kilometers of water supply pipes successfully laid out of the targeted 5 kilometers. He urged the concerned agencies to expedite their efforts to accomplish the remaining portion of the project before the onset of harsh winter.

“As the winter season draws near, the focus must shift towards ensuring the prompt completion of these projects. This will guarantee enhanced and enduring amenities for the residents of Shadab Karewa. The administration remains resolute in fulfilling the community’s aspirations, striving for comprehensive advancement throughout the entire region. The engineers have performed admirably, and I have directed them to prioritize the quality of their work, which will yield lasting advantages,” said Ajaz Ahmad Bhat.

The Prabhari Officer also paid a visit to Government High School, Shadab Karewa where he interacted with the students. During this interaction, he motivated the students to cultivate self-reliance and nurture an innovative mindset from a young age. These qualities, he emphasized, would enable them to effectively tackle life’s various challenges. He also took note of the school’s commendable work culture and praised the Headmaster and his team for promoting such an environment for growth and development of students.

In addition to the aforementioned projects, Prabhari Officer Ajaz Ahmad Bhat traversed various other developmental initiatives within the Shadab Karewa region. He interacted with local officials, engineers, and community members to gain insights into the ground-level implementation of these projects. His visit aimed not only to assess the physical progress but also to ensure that the projects align with the broader developmental goals of the area.
